New wound dressing put to the test against diabetic foot ulcers
NCT ID NCT06667752
First seen Sep 18, 2026 · Last updated Sep 18, 2026
Summary
Researchers are testing a new antibacterial wound dressing to see if it helps heal diabetic foot ulcers better than a standard silver dressing. The trial enrolls adults with diabetic foot ulcers that have lasted more than four weeks. Participants are randomly assigned to receive either the new dressing or the standard dressing for four weeks, followed by eight weeks of standard care. The main goal is to measure wound healing at 12 weeks.

Copied word for word from the study's registry entry, so the wording is the study team's rather than ours.
Inclusion Criteria: * Voluntary, written informed consent obtained prior to any study related activities. * Males and females aged ≥18 years. * DFU(s) present for more than 4 weeks with a maximum diameter of 4 cm. * IWGDF/IDSA Wound infection grades 1 (absent) or 2. * Patients willing and able to comply with scheduled visits, laboratory sampling and study procedures. * Ankle-brachial index (ABI) 0.9-1.4 or ABI between 0.6-0.9 with ankle pressure ≥ 70 mmHg. Exclusion Criteria: * Ssystemic or topical antibiotic therapy within 7 days before the enrolment. * Any wound with known associated osteomyelitis or positive probe-to-bone test. * Previous randomization in this clinical trial. * Surgical procedures in the same leg as the index ulcer(s) (e.g., radical debridement, ulcerectomy, skin grafting, exostectomy, amputation) within the past four weeks, or planned to during the study. * Use of other advanced therapies directly involving the index ulcer(s) (e.g. skin substitutes, matrices, cellbased therapies or products) within the past four weeks. * Patients suffering cardiac disorders grade NYHA IV. * Patients suffering hepatic disorders grade Child-Pugh C. * Stage 4 cancer. * Women of childbearing potential who are pregnant, breast-feeding or not using adequate contraceptive methods.
